I prefer a small block, I'm not at all interested in a 460 SPF for myself. But the question posed is "re-sale" value.

OK,,,,the PROBLEM with a 427 FE (in an SPF or any other Cobra) as far as "re-sale" goes is this:

It cost a LOT more money to put in a 427 as opposed to a 460. It is doubtful you will recover your "investment" because of that. But there is little doubt the 427 will sell for MORE money than a 460. Will you LOOSE more or less percentage with a 460 or a 427 then becomes the question.


Generally speaking I think you will loose MORE by putting in a 427, UNLESS you get a really good deal on the motor! But a 427 SPF will sell WAY FASTER than a 460. I bet you wouldn't even have to advertise it. When was the last time YOU saw an SPF with a 427 for sale? Thats a RARE car!

351W bored/stroked to 427? Not good in my book, TO punched out, TO "over the top" for that block. I'll take one a little smaller please. Alloy 427, like from Shelby? Cool, can I get that for say, $50K total package price? Dream on, IF you find one at that price, BUY IT!
